Majority of the times Routers do not obtain the IP address assigned by the ISP, the solution to this common problem is : 1. Make sure that the cable or DSL modem is connected properly. 2. Always try to reset the cable or DSL modem by powering the modem off and on. 3. If by any chance dynamic IP addressing is being used, make sure that the cable or DSL modem is DHCP- capable. 4. The most important of them all some ISP’S specially require a MAC address registered with them. And what if the above procedure fails, quite a tricky problem indeed, but with a three step solution too. 1. Resetting the cable modem or DSL modem by powering the unit off and on should solve the problem. 2. The next step should be to download the latest release of the firmware from the manufacturer’s site. 3. Resetting the router’s factory default . And what if emails are not accessible, then …..do the following. 1. Connecting your computer directly to the cable modem should solve the issue. 2. next ping the ISP web server. And what if you are not able to get the web configuration screen for the router , the solution to this problem is quite simple, remove proxy settings on the internet browser or remove the dial up settings on your browser.
